Klaviyo charges you for how many contacts you collect — not how many emails you send. At 50,000 contacts that's around $700 a month, over $8,000 a year, and it only climbs as you grow. This is the full kit to build the same system I run instead: your own email platform sending off Amazon SES, where storing contacts costs nothing and sending costs pennies per thousand. It's not one prompt — it's five sections that walk you through the whole build, in order: standing up Amazon SES, doing DNS and domain authentication the right way (the part that gets people rejected), building it as a Shopify custom app, recreating my exact automated flows and campaign engine, and branding your transactional emails. “Won't Amazon just reject me?”
That's the exact part the kit is built around. Section 1 and 2 cover requesting production access properly and authenticating a dedicated sending subdomain — the setup that gets you approved instead of bounced.
“Will my emails land in spam?”
Not when the domain auth and warm-up are done right. The kit uses separate marketing and transactional subdomains, full DKIM/SPF/DMARC, and a metered warm-up ramp so your reputation builds clean.
“Is it really that much cheaper?”
Amazon bills about ten cents per thousand emails sent, and nothing to store contacts. Against ~$700/month at 50,000 contacts, it isn't close — the whole thing runs for well under a hundred a month.
